When the copyboard cover is closed to about 30°, the copyboard cover open/closed sen-
sor (PS111) goes ON. The original detection/reader motor drive PCB reads the output lev-
els of the original size sensors at intervals of 0.125 sec for 15 sec after the copyboard
cover open/closed sensor goes ON or between when the copyboard cover open/closed sen-
sor goes ON and when the Start key is pressed. If it detects a change in the level, it identi-
fies the condition as the absence of an original; if there is no change, it will identify the
condition as the presence of an original. This way of identification enables the machine to
detect the size of a black original.
In the case of conditions a and b in the following, the output level of the sensor remains
unchanged, at times causing the machine to make the wrong detection. If, for condition c,
i.e., A3 (11x17) is selected with priority and A3 (11x17) paper is absent, the cassette se-
lected for standard mode will be selected.
a. A3 (11x17) Black Original
b. Book original (The thickness of the original prevents the copyboard cover from closing
fully, making it difficult to detect a change in the sensor level.)
c. Copyboard cover (not closed)
